Compatibility Comes First
The first thing I check is whether the adapter works with my device. I make sure my laptop, tablet, or phone has a USB-C port that supports data transfer. Some USB-C ports are only for charging, so I always confirm compatibility before buying. I also check whether the adapter supports my operating system, such as Windows, macOS, ChromeOS, iPadOS, or Linux.
Speed and Performance Matter
I look at the Ethernet speed rating before choosing an adapter. A basic adapter may support 10/100 Mbps, while better models support Gigabit Ethernet up to 1 Gbps. For my needs, I usually prefer a Gigabit adapter because it gives me better performance for streaming, large downloads, and online meetings. If my internet plan is faster, I want an adapter that can keep up.
Build Quality and Portability
I like an adapter that feels sturdy and is easy to carry. A metal housing often feels more durable than cheap plastic, especially when I travel. Since I may use it with a laptop bag or at a desk, I prefer a compact design that does not take up much space. A flexible cable or a small dongle-style adapter also makes it easier for me to manage.
Driver-Free Plug and Play Use
I always check whether the adapter is plug and play. I prefer one that works without needing extra drivers or software installation. This saves me time and avoids compatibility issues. When I am setting up a new device, I want the adapter to work immediately after plugging it in.
Extra Features I Find Useful
Sometimes I look for extra features that make the adapter more practical. A pass-through charging port is helpful when I want to charge my laptop while using Ethernet. Some adapters also include USB-A ports or HDMI output, which can be useful if I want fewer accessories on my desk. I only choose these if I actually need the added functions.
Cable Length and Design
If the adapter has a built-in cable, I pay attention to the length. A short cable is fine for portability, but a slightly longer one can be more convenient on a desk. I also make sure the connector fits securely and does not feel loose. A good design helps prevent accidental disconnects during work or gaming.
